Transaction 17221bae0675c9eb7390053c0cfd8f7ae3c69cf448009f2a9dc41a280aadbc20

1 Input
2 Outputs
  • 17221bae0675c9eb7390053c0cfd8f7ae3c69cf448009f2a9dc41a280aadbc20:0
  • value  633296
    address  12xHa4y8dZ5rCAxwHf6M5GozZGdXNH4ASc
  • 17221bae0675c9eb7390053c0cfd8f7ae3c69cf448009f2a9dc41a280aadbc20:1
  • value  1049781
    address  18vZrh4g8Ehak6aF5yPE7dyyrP89ZNDDEh